Carriages in this condition standing in trains yards, are becoming more and more rare. I usually saw them on the first line of tracks in big train yards of metropolitan cities. These carriages have been standing there for many years waiting to be demolished. When graffiti writers enter the yard, they will pass by this first line of tracks, before going to paint running trains. Graffiti writers often test spray cans on these old carriages. They also come back to paint them after painting running trains on the way back. They usually make small plain pieces or tags on it. That's how after many years these carriages become to look so over-tagged. Carriages can be a great decoration for your layout or just a super unique piece together with diorama in your collection.
